    January 30, 2023 - Remarkable complexity and interest at the price
    This whiskey is good enough to invite comparison to more-expensive bottles. All the caramel, vanilla, and soft spices you might find in bottles costing double this. The notes are common to many good whiskies, so the points here are not for innovation, but because everything is harmonious and working so well together. At this price, this will likely be a near-permanent resident on my bar.

    October 8, 2019 - Pale yellow, somewhat 'thin'.
    A very rum-like nose. Fruity characteristics of pineapple and banana, lots of oak.
    Taste follows the nose. I would have guessed this was aged in old rum barrels. Medium finish. A little metallic on the back end. Not a bad Whiskey by any means. Can be sipped (better if needing some bodily warmth), or mixed.
